
Former Premier League player Roni Stam has been sentenced to seven years in prison for his part in a €41.5 million drug smuggling operation.
The 41-year-old has been charged with conspiracy to smuggle more than two tons of cocaine into the Netherlands. The Dutch Public Prosecution Service alleges that Stam is a key player in that multi-million dollar operation.
There were calls for Stam to be jailed for 13 years, but the judge at the Breda court acquitted him of two more serious charges. He was convicted of trafficking 724 kilograms of cocaine, as well as large quantities of MDMA and nitrous oxide.

Stam and his associates are accused of smuggling drugs from South America, with a money laundering ring worth £2.2 million.
Stam admits to being involved in a plot to send 20 kilograms of cocaine to the German city of Frankfurt from Brazil.
He claimed that his payment for it was "a sum worth one kilogram" and that he regrets his involvement with any leader of the criminal network.
